    Neutrino are massless in the Standard Model. The most popular mechanism to generate neutrino masses are the type I and type II seesaw, where right-handed neutrinos and a scalar triplet are augmented to the Standard Model, respectively. In this work, we discuss a model where a type I + II seesaw mechanism naturally arises via spontaneous symmetry breaking of an enlarged gauge group. Lepton flavor violation is a common feature in such setup and for this reason, we compute the model contribution to the μeγ\mu \rightarrow e\gamma and μ3e\mu \rightarrow 3e decays. Moreover, we explore the connection between the neutrino mass ordering and lepton flavor violation in perspective with the LHC, HL-LHC and HE-LHC sensitivities to the doubly charged scalar stemming from the Higgs triplet. Our results explicitly show the importance of searching for signs of lepton flavor violation in collider and muon decays. The conclusion about which probe yields stronger bounds depends strongly on the mass ordering adopted, the absolute neutrino masses and which much decay one considers. In the 1-5 TeV mass region of the doubly charged scalar, lepton flavor violation experiments and colliders offer orthogonal and complementary probes.     Transfer-matrix methods on finite-width strips with free boundary conditions are applied to lattice site animals, which provide a model for randomly branched polymers in a good solvent. By assigning a distinct fugacity to sites along the strip edges, critical properties at the special (adsorption) and ordinary transitions are assessed. The crossover exponent at the adsorption point is estimated as ϕ=0.505±0.015\phi = 0.505 \pm 0.015, consistent with recent predictions that ϕ=1/2\phi = 1/2 exactly for all space dimensionalities.Comment: 10 pages, LaTeX with Institute of Physics macros, to appear in Journal of Physics

    Little is known about the jumping plant-lice of Brazil from where seven families, 45 genera and 76 species have been previously reported, but estimates suggest that there may be as many as 1,000 species. This study reports 34 species of Psylloidea which were collected along the edges of Amazon?Cerrado natural transitional forests in the municipality of Sorriso, state of Mato Grosso, from August 2013 to July 2014.     Numerical results for the first gap of the Lyapunov spectrum of the self-dual random-bond Ising model on strips are analysed. It is shown that finite-width corrections can be fitted very well by an inverse logarithmic form, predicted to hold when the Hamiltonian contains a marginal operator.Comment: LaTeX code with Institute of Physics macros for 7 pages, plus 2 Postscript figures; to appear in Journal of Physics A (Letter to the Editor

    We consider the one-dimensional totally asymmetric simple exclusion process (TASEP) with position-dependent hopping rates. The problem is solved,in a mean field/adiabatic approximation, for a general (smooth) form of spatial rate variation. Numerical simulations of systems with hopping rates varying linearly against position (constant rate gradient), for both periodic and open boundary conditions, provide detailed confirmation of theoretical predictions, concerning steady-state average density profiles and currents, as well as open-system phase boundaries, to excellent numerical accuracy.Comment: RevTeX 4.1, 14 pages, 9 figures (published version

    As cultivares de melancia no Brasil apresentam frutos de bom teor de açúcar, mas são pouco produtivas, suscetíveis a doenças (Sphaerotheca fuliginea, Didimella bryoniae e viroses) e têm frutos grandes. Considerando a existência de linhas diplóides e tetraplóides com boa homozigose e que a resistência é monogênica e dominante, foram obtidas combinações híbridas diplóides e triplóides as quais foram avaliadas em 2001 e 2002 no Campo Experimental de Bebedouro, em Petrolina-PE, utilizando-se irrigação por gotejamento no espaçamento de 3 m entre fileiras e 0,80 m entre plantas. Na colheita foram avaliados produção por planta e peso de fruto (kg), teor de sólidos solúveis (°Brix), ocamento da polpa e número de sementes perfeitas nas ombinações triplóides. A maioria das combinações híbridas apresentou mais de dez quilogramas por planta, frutos de 4 a 12 kg e teor de sólidos solúveis acima de 10 °Brix e e, portanto, muito semelhantes às testemunhas. No entanto, algumas combinações híbridas apresentaram ocamento da polpa e sementes perfeitas (combinações triplóides) necessitando continuar a seleção para esses dois caracteres.Suplemento.Edição de Resumos expandidos e palestras do 43.
